Chandana shines for Gloucs

Sri Lanka leg-spinner Upul Chandana took three wickets for 73 runs as Gloucestershire forced Glamorgan to follow-on on the second day of their county championship cricket match played at Cardiff.

Replying to Gloucestershire's mammoth first innings score of 466 (Chandana 14), Glamorgan were dismissed for 239 and following on were 93-1 with Chandana making the breakthrough. Chandana's Sri Lankan team mate Muttiah Muralitharan picked up two wickets for 45 runs to help Lancashire dismiss Derbyshire for 215.

By the close of the second day Lancashire had replied with 175-1. Sanath Jayasuriya failed twice with the bat for Somerset but took two wickets for two runs off three overs with his left-arm spin to dismiss Durham for 298 at Grangefield Road. The left-handed opener batting at no. 4 made two and 17 in Somerset's totals of 252 and 88-3 by the end of the second day.
